How I got started

“I am often asked how I got started as a Virtual Assistant. The truth be told the RELATIONSHIPS I built with local business owners began long before I began my VA business. Below are some of the key tools and classes I utilized as I began my amazing journey to build AssistantAngel to what it is today.”

~ Angel

Smart Moms Job Placement

Immediate Part Time Work

When I first began looking for work, I knew small business networking was the way to go.  I joined Smart Moms.  Smart Moms is a job resource site (run by a mom of 2).  It is a job placement site for companies to find part time virtual and in office support.  I got many job leads for part time employment from this site.  As a mom of two small children, this appealed to my life circumstances at that time.

Relationships built through Networking

Without a question, in person networking and connecting with local business owners has been one of the most powerful ways to encourage and connect with local business owners. These relationships have resulted in business for many of us.

It was Pat Howlett and Inside919 that gave me the opportunity to truly get to connect with local business owners on a consistent basis. When I joined the 919 Community, there were 800 members. Currently, Inside919 has over 3,100 local business owners.
